The Japanese name for this type of knife is a “Petty” knife. The Hazaki utility knife is light and nimble and perfect for small jobs like peeling and slicing. It also has a very useful pointed point.

The longer blade generally gives the knife a forward balance that allows it to work for you. While the blade would ideally slide forward or backward while cutting, the Gyuto is also ideal for people who prefer to "cradle" their knife while cutting.

Mineral oil hydrates the wood and keeps it healthy, while beeswax stays on the surface and creates a protective layer that allows the wood to stay hydrated for longer!
Simply apply the product generously, let it sit for a few hours and wipe off the excess.

Easily maintain the sharpness of your knives with the Hazaki ceramic sharpening rod. Designed to maintain the performance of your blades between full sharpening sessions, it gently realigns the knife's edge to prolong its sharpness and optimize every cut.
With each use, even the sharpest knives experience a slight bend in their edge, reducing cutting accuracy. The ceramic sharpening rod corrects this phenomenon by realigning the edge without removing material, which maintains the blade's durability and limits the frequency of more aggressive sharpening.
It's simple and effective to use: 3 to 6 light strokes on each side of the blade are enough to restore a precise edge. No need to apply a lot of pressure or speed - a controlled and steady movement provides the best results. Robust and ergonomic design for a secure grip.
